BILOXI, Miss. � Mississippi Sea Wolves coach Bob Woods announced today defenseman Jim Baxter has been placed on the 7-day injured reserve and right wing Stu Pietersma (PEET-uhrs-mah) has been activated from the injured reserve.
Baxter, 23, leads all East Coast Hockey League defensemen with 74 points. He has tallied 16 goals and collected 58 assists in 68 games. The 6-foot-3 and 215-pound native of Brantford, Ontario was named the alternate captain of the Southern Conference Compuware / All-Star Game held in Estero, Florida on January 21. Baxter is in his second season with the Sea Wolves and fourth year of professional hockey.
Pietersma, 21, leads the ECHL with 31 fighting majors. The 6-foot-2 and 225-pound native of Fort Saskatchewan, Alberta has scored three goals, added six assists for nine points, plus he has picked up 250 penalty minutes in 52 games with Mississippi this season. Pietersma was acquired off waivers from the Wheeling Nailers on October 21. He registered 19 penalty minutes over three games with Wheeling to begin his rookie season.
